  • Pete.8Pete.8 Posts: 11,340

    It will also depend on the variety.

    This year I've grown 'hi-scent' and 'elegant ladies' - both very strongly scented and just 3 flowers on each stem. These are heirloom type sweet p's.

    Modern varieties can have 7 flowers per stem. 

    What variety do you have?
